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
210871 5866676331 835 29255
018251435 93
018251435 93
0884775767 71 4601587 830
All about undefined
Interested in learning more?
018251435 93
0884775767 71 4601587 830
See more
5872 52
05 905842897 6668866
See more
44115076 72344880 77
09172263 5672937785 141 493421493
See more